Find the derivative of x2 – 2 at x = 10.

= `lim_(h → 0)(f(a + h) - f(a))/h`

∴ Derivative of x2 − 2 at x = 10

= `lim_(h → 0) ([(10 + h)^2 - 2]- (10^2 - 2))/h`

= `lim_(h → 0) (100 + 20h + h^2 - 2 - 100 + 2)/h`

= `lim_(h → 0) (20h + h^2)/h`

= `lim_(h → 0) (20 + h)`

= 20
